Rockwell Collins




 

Annual Sales $4.4 billion

Rank 1st (Revenue between $1-5 billion)

Average Five-Year Score Improvement 13th (up 5%)

The model for how aerospace companies should be run, this avionics supplier has achieved continuous improvement year after year. Focused and innovative, the company has consistently grown earnings faster than revenue, in part by developing specialized products that yield high profit margins. It has avoided pricey acquisitions and made sizable stock repurchases that bolstered enterprise value. The reason Rockwell Collins doesn't rank higher in five-year improvement is that it can't climb much farther.
